HTML input Tag

HTML <input> Tag

Example

A simple HTML form with two input fields and one submit button:

<form action="form_action.asp" method="get">
  First name: <input type="text" name="fname" /><br />
  Last name: <input type="text" name="lname" /><br />
  <input type="submit" value="Submit" />
</form>

Try it yourself »
(more examples at the bottom of this page)

Definition and Usage

The <input> tag is used to select user information.

An input field can vary in many ways, depending on the type attribute. An input field can be a text field, a checkbox, a password field, a radio button, a button, and more.


Browser Support

The <input> tag is supported in all major browsers.


Differences Between HTML and XHTML

In HTML, the <input> tag has no end tag.

In XHTML, the <input> tag must be properly closed, like this <input />.


Tips and Notes

Tip: Use the <label> tag to define labels for input elements.


Optional Attributes

DTD indicates in which HTML 4.01/XHTML 1.0 DTD the attribute is allowed. S=Strict, T=Transitional, and F=Frameset.

AttributeValueDescriptionDTD
acceptMIME_typeSpecifies the types of files that can be submitted through a file upload (only for type="file")STF
alignleft
right
top
middle
bottom
Deprecated. Use styles instead.
Specifies the alignment of an image input (only for type="image")
TF
alttextSpecifies an alternate text for an image input (only for type="image")STF
checkedchecked Specifies that an input element should be preselected when the page loads (for type="checkbox" or type="radio")STF
disableddisabledSpecifies that an input element should be disabled when the page loadsSTF
maxlengthnumberSpecifies the maximum length (in characters) of an input field (for type="text" or type="password")STF
namenameSpecifies a name for an input elementSTF
readonlyreadonlySpecifies that an input field should be read-only (for type="text" or type="password")STF
sizenumberSpecifies the width of an input fieldSTF
srcURLSpecifies the URL to an image to display as a submit button (only for type="image")STF
typebutton
checkbox
file
hidden
image
password
radio
reset
submit
text
Specifies the type of an input elementSTF
valuevalueSpecifies the value of an input elementSTF


Standard Attributes

The <input> tag supports the following standard attributes:

AttributeValueDescriptionDTD
accesskeycharacterSpecifies a keyboard shortcut to access an elementSTF
classclassnameSpecifies a classname for an elementSTF
dirrtl
ltr
Specifies the text directionfor the content in an elementSTF
ididSpecifies a unique id for an elementSTF
langlanguage_codeSpecifies a language code for the content in an elementSTF
stylestyle_definitionSpecifies an inline style for an elementSTF
tabindexnumberSpecifies the tab order of an elementSTF
titletextSpecifies extra information about an elementSTF
xml:langlanguage_codeSpecifies a language code for the content in an element, in XHTML documentsSTF

More information about Standard Attributes.


Event Attributes

The <input> tag supports the following event attributes:

AttributeValueDescriptionDTD
onblurscriptScript to be run when an element loses focusSTF
onchangescriptScript to be run when an element changeSTF
onclickscriptScript to be run on a mouse clickSTF
ondblclickscriptScript to be run on a mouse double-clickSTF
onfocusscriptScript to be run when an element gets focusSTF
onmousedownscriptScript to be run when mouse button is pressedSTF
onmousemovescriptScript to be run when mouse pointer movesSTF
onmouseoutscriptScript to be run when mouse pointer moves out of an elementSTF
onmouseoverscriptScript to be run when mouse pointer moves over an elementSTF
onmouseupscriptScript to be run when mouse button is releasedSTF
onkeydownscriptScript to be run when a key is pressedSTF
onkeypressscriptScript to be run when a key is pressed and releasedSTF
onkeyupscriptScript to be run when a key is releasedSTF
onselectscriptScript to be run when an element is selectedSTF

More information about Event Attributes.


评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值